Output 6310d50882d7ed66dc7cef4c491bbb62e38106b4526148bd1d3daa43b90c7820:2

value
14024396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d87dc8314aa2dee4b4ed41ee0be096dbd16a2448 OP_EQUAL
address
3MRiZTyMnFaKbmwpnfWGukx9h4nYNUot2Y
transaction
6310d50882d7ed66dc7cef4c491bbb62e38106b4526148bd1d3daa43b90c7820
spent
true